Maroa-Forsyth's game last Thursday was a tough loss, but they didn't let that memory haunt them on Friday. They were the clear victor by a 16-3 margin over the Clinton Maroons. The high-flying hitting performance was a huge turnaround for Maroa-Forsyth considering their one-run performance the matchup before.
Kelci Kahlher was a standout: she went 3-for-4 with three runs, four RBI, and two doubles. The team also got some help courtesy of Aubrey Stewart, who went 2-for-4 with a home run, three RBI, and two runs.
The win got Maroa-Forsyth back to even at 3-3. As for Clinton, they have been struggling recently as they've lost four of their last five matches, which put a noticeable dent in their 3-4 record this season.
